Recent Advancements in Machine Learning and Sentiment Analysis Technologies in Healthcare and Brand Management: A Review
Supriya Mishra , Prof Y.D.S.Arya , Dr. Vimal Mishra
Abstract
This paper discusses the application of machine learning technology in the healthcare system, specifically in the context of heart disease detection. The study utilizes various machine learning algorithms, such as the KNN algorithm, decision tree method, and random forest algorithm, to create a predictive model for heart disease detection. The sentiment analysis method is also applied in the healthcare system for risk detection in patients. The study also identifies some of the obstacles faced in the data collection process and proposes solutions to overcome these problems. The findings of this study suggest that the application of machine learning technology and sentiment analysis in healthcare can play a significant role in the early detection and prevention of heart disease, which can help save lives and improve the quality of healthcare services
